When Netlink attends a "move the NBN box" call, the first job is an honest site assessment. Nine times out of ten the customer's actual problem is Wi-Fi coverage or router placement rather than the physical location of the NBN Connection Box itself. Because NBN-supplied equipment is regulated, moving the NTD triggers Authority to Alter engagement and takes longer and costs more than the customer expects. Meanwhile, running a Cat6 tail from the existing NTD to a central router position — or adding a hardwired access point — usually solves the underlying problem in a single visit at a fraction of the cost.

Common Wi-Fi dead-spot scenarios
Run Cat6 from the garage NTD through the ceiling void to a central hallway or living-room location, and mount the router on an internal wall — not on a shelf in the garage where the concrete walls absorb Wi-Fi.
The cupboard door plus the plasterboard on either side is enough to cut Wi-Fi throughput in half. Either mount the router outside the cupboard (short Cat6 to a wall plate next to the door), or install a dedicated hardwired access point in the room that needs coverage.
A common builder default that puts the router at one far corner of the home. Netlink runs Ethernet to a central point and adds a mesh node or wired access point in the living zone.
Wi-Fi radiates outward like a light bulb — a corner installation wastes half the coverage into empty air outside the home. Relocating the router (or adding a hardwired access point) to a central ceiling position solves the coverage problem for a fraction of what an NTD move costs.
When is a physical NBN box relocation actually the right call?
- The NTD sits in a room being demolished, extended or converted (kitchen extension, second-storey add).
- The NTD is on an external wall that's being re-clad or replaced.
- The current NTD position no longer has a compliant 240 V power supply on a maintained circuit.
- A property purchase or long-term tenancy change makes a permanent internal relocation genuinely necessary.
- Every reasonable router-side or Cat6-tail alternative has been considered and ruled out.
Even in these cases, Netlink confirms the Authority-to-Alter path with the customer before quoting the physical move, and refers work to the customer's provider or NBN where the applicable requirements demand it.
NBN technology determines what can be moved — and how.
Each NBN technology uses different equipment. The relocation path that's possible on FTTP is not the same as on FTTN or HFC. Netlink confirms the technology on-site before quoting.
Fibre runs directly to the property and terminates at an NBN Connection Box. Physical NTD relocation is only permitted under applicable NBN Authority to Alter rules and may require your provider to raise a service request. In most cases, running Cat6 from the existing NTD to a better router location is the recommended path.
The modem plugs into a wall socket. Socket relocation, dedicated modem-socket installation and bridge-tap removal are all standard customer-side work. Line performance is often sensitive to how well the internal cabling is set up, so relocation is a chance to tidy the entire internal line.
In apartment buildings, fibre reaches a communications room in the building and copper delivers to each unit's wall socket. In-unit socket relocation is customer-side and can be performed inside the unit boundary. Work beyond the unit boundary usually needs building manager and provider engagement.
Fibre reaches a curb-side distribution point and a small NBN Connection Device sits inside the property. Similar to FTTP — physical NCD relocation follows Authority to Alter rules, and Cat6 from the NCD to a better router location is usually the practical answer.
Signal is delivered on the coaxial network to a wall outlet and NBN Connection Box. Where the NBN Connection Box sits in a poor room, Cat6 from the NBN Connection Box to a better router location is normally the most reliable relocation approach.
Property access and cable-route considerations
Where the Cat6 tail or the physical relocation actually goes depends on the property. Netlink assesses:
- Ceiling void — accessibility, manhole location, insulation depth, existing HVAC and mechanical service routing
- Wall cavities — timber-frame or cavity-brick construction, header studs and noggins that block a top-down pull
- Underfloor — subfloor height, mechanical services, moisture and pest exposure, brick pier layout
- External pathway — eave depth, weatherproof entry seals, salt-air exposure in lake/coast suburbs
- Existing conduits — draw wires, spare ways, whether a fresh conduit can be installed non-destructively
- Feature walls, tiled walls and finished ceilings — pathways that would require plaster repair are quoted separately

Socket relocation (FTTN / FTTB / FTTC)
On copper-lead NBN connections, the modem plugs directly into a wall socket. Netlink can install a new modem socket, relocate an existing socket, install a dedicated single-drop from the first / lead-in socket, and remove unused telephone branches (bridge-tap removal) that can degrade VDSL sync. On completion, the internal line is tested and a written report is provided.

NBN box, socket & modem relocation FAQs
Can I move my NBN box myself?
No. The NBN Connection Box (NTD) is NBN-supplied equipment and any physical relocation must be performed by an appropriately-registered cabler working under the applicable NBN Authority to Alter requirements. Some relocation work must still be referred to your internet provider or NBN. Netlink assesses the site first and confirms which path is permitted before quoting.
Is it cheaper to move the router or move the NBN box?
In almost every home, moving the router (or running Ethernet from the NTD to a better router position) is significantly cheaper and quicker than moving the NBN Connection Box itself. Because moving the router does not touch NBN-supplied equipment, no Authority to Alter is triggered and the whole job is customer-side cabling work.
The builder put the NBN box in the garage — can I get better Wi-Fi without moving it?
Yes. This is one of the most common calls Netlink attends. The standard fix is to run Cat6 from the garage NTD through the ceiling void or roof space to a central hallway or living-room position and install the router or a hardwired access point there. The NTD stays where NBN installed it, and Wi-Fi coverage improves dramatically.
Can Netlink relocate an NBN socket in an apartment?
Yes, within the unit boundary. On FTTB apartment connections, the wall socket inside the unit can be re-terminated or relocated as customer-side cabling. Work beyond the unit boundary — for example, changes in the building's common comms room — usually needs building manager engagement and may need to be coordinated through your provider.
Can you install a modem socket where there isn't one?
Yes. On FTTN, FTTB and FTTC connections, a new modem socket can be installed as a dedicated single-drop from the first / lead-in socket. This is often combined with removing unused telephone sockets (bridge-tap removal) which can improve VDSL line quality on FTTN and FTTB.

How long does an NBN box relocation take?
Straightforward router relocations with a short Cat6 run typically complete in one visit of a few hours. Physical NTD relocation, multi-storey homes and cases needing Authority to Alter engagement can take longer and may involve a follow-up visit. Netlink confirms the expected timeline during the site assessment.
Will my internet be down while the work is happening?
There is normally a short outage during the actual re-termination. Netlink schedules the physical cut-over for the end of the visit so the customer's data plan and streaming devices are re-connected before we leave. On FTTN and FTTB, a wall-socket relocation can be sequenced so the existing socket stays live until the new socket is ready.
